Southwood Manor is a one-tract neighborhood of South Jordan, UT, population 6,507. Scored across those inputs it reaches 3/10, placing it in the Lower tier. Pulling the other way is economic stress, at 1.1/10.

On the softer side is eviction-process difficulty, at 1.9/10. SNAP participation is 3.5% of households versus 15.2% nationally. Court records for this tract carry 19 eviction filings.

Food insecurity affects 8.5% of adults, 9.3 points below the national rate. Filing activity peaked in 2010 at 7.6% of renter households.

The most recent observed rate, 0.9% in 2016, is well off that peak. That places it #2 of 10 neighborhoods in South Jordan.

The closest comparables inside the same city are Creekside Village and North Station District. Poverty sits at 4%, low enough that arrears here usually reflect a specific shock rather than a structural income gap.

One tract means one number: 3/10 applies directly to any address inside the boundary. The number is rebuilt whenever its ACS, court-record, or statutory inputs change.
